Ordinals
beta
Sat 1990900436594896
decimal
67434.21636594896
percentile
3.981800873189792%
name
mbbfutrxsxjt
cycle
0
epoch
2
block
67434
offset
21636594896
timestamp
2024-03-16 06:41:50 UTC
rarity
common
prev
next